上一篇
如何为动态IP搭建专属域名解析服务器?
- 行业动态
- 2025-05-04
- 3135
动态IP域名解析服务器可通过实时更新域名与变动公网IP的绑定关系,解决个人网络无固定IP的访问难题,用户借助DDNS服务商或自建软件(如DNSPod、阿里云解析),配置客户端自动上报IP变化,实现通过固定域名远程访问家庭NAS、摄像头等设备,适用于网络监控、私有云搭建等场景。
什么是动态IP域名解析?
当个人或家庭网络使用动态IP(即公网IP地址不定期变化)时,通过动态域名解析(DDNS)技术,可以将一个固定的域名(如yourname.example.com
)绑定到动态变化的IP地址上,用户通过访问域名即可连接到本地设备,无需手动更新IP地址。
为什么需要动态IP解析服务器?
- 远程访问需求
家庭NAS、智能设备、私有云盘等需通过公网访问,但动态IP变化会导致连接中断。 - 低成本解决方案
动态IP通常由宽带运营商免费提供,搭配DDNS服务可替代高价固定IP。 - 灵活性
支持个人网站、游戏服务器、监控系统等场景的快速部署。
如何搭建动态IP域名解析服务?
步骤1:选择DDNS服务商
- 免费方案:Cloudflare、DuckDNS、No-IP(基础功能)
- 国内推荐:阿里云DNS、酷盾DNSPod、花生壳(稳定性高)
步骤2:注册域名并绑定DDNS
- 购买域名(如阿里云、Namecheap)或在免费平台获取子域名。
- 在域名DNS管理后台添加“A记录”,指向DDNS服务商提供的更新地址。
步骤3:配置本地设备或路由器
- 路由器内置DDNS:登录路由器后台(如华硕、TP-Link),填写服务商提供的账户和主机名。
- 软件客户端:在电脑/服务器安装DDNS客户端(如ddclient、花生壳客户端),定时向服务商发送IP更新请求。
步骤4:验证与测试
- 使用
ping yourdomain.com
检查域名是否解析到当前IP。 - 通过端口映射(NAT)开放本地服务端口(如HTTP 80、SSH 22)。
安全与优化建议
- 启用HTTPS:使用Let’s Encrypt免费证书加密数据传输,防止中间人攻击。
- 防火墙规则:仅开放必要端口,限制访问IP范围。
- 双因素认证(2FA):在DDNS服务商和本地设备中启用,提升账户安全性。
- IPv6支持:若运营商提供IPv6,可配置AAAA记录,避免IPv4端口封锁问题。
常见问题解答
Q:动态IP解析延迟高怎么办?
A:选择就近的DNS服务商(如国内用户优选阿里云);检查本地网络带宽和路由器性能。
Q:DDNS服务中断如何排查?
A:
- 检查客户端日志是否正常发送IP更新请求。
- 确认域名解析状态(通过
nslookup
或在线DNS检测工具)。 - 联系服务商确认API接口是否稳定。
Q:动态IP被运营商封锁怎么办?
A:尝试更换端口(如将HTTP 80改为非标端口),或申请商用宽带获取固定IP。
进阶方案:自建DDNS服务器
若对隐私和可控性要求高,可通过以下方式自建:
- 使用脚本(Python/Bash)定时获取本机IP,并通过API更新到云DNS(如Cloudflare)。
- 部署开源工具如
ddns-route53
(支持AWS Route 53)。 - 结合Docker容器化部署,实现自动维护。
引用与工具
- 域名注册:Namecheap、阿里云
- DDNS服务:Cloudflare、DuckDNS
- 端口检测:CanYouSeeMe
- 安全证书:Let’s Encrypt
提示:操作前请备份配置,确保遵守当地法律法规及运营商政策。